This design is a hybrid between a wide triangular shawl and a crescent shape, worked in two-colour stripes of varying depths, using a number of different lace patterns and areas of garter stitch and stocking stitch for added texture. Increases are worked at both side edges and either side of a central spine stitch. Two versions are offered, in both 4-ply and lace weights. The laceweight includes an extra stripe. (To make a smaller laceweight version, you could follow the instructions for the 4-ply shawl while using 3.25mm needles with a laceweight yarn.)

100g/450m of each colour is required for the 4-ply version, which measures 230cm (90 inches) across the wingspan of the upper edge, and 92cm (36 inches) deep at centre back.

100g/800m of each colour is needed for the laceweight version, which measures 290cm (114 inches) across the upper edge and 107cm (42 inches) deep.

The edging has optional beading - approximately 500 beads are required for the 4-ply version and 750 for the laceweight.

My samples started and finished with the darker colour yarn but you can of course vary this as preferred.

The design is suitable for intermediate to advanced knitters with a considerable level of experience. The lace pattern requires concentration as each section is different, and there is a very large number of stitches on the needle at the end.
